See <https://builds.apache.org/job/Allura/1120/changes>

Changes:

[dave] Downgrade 'requests' version a little bit.

[dave] [#7981] show appropriate items for anonymous users, tighten up thread

[dave] [#7981] make thread moderate panel a little nicer looking

[dave] [#7981] remove old thread subscription field, use modern

[dave] [#7981] allow notifications to be fired against multiple artifacts so

[dave] [#7981] frontend bugfix, cleanup, and consolidation

[dave] [#7981] don't allow overlapping subscriptions between Forums and its

[dave] [#7981] disable per-thread checkboxes form, when subscribed at a higher

[dave] [#7981] SubscriptionForm gets subscribed_to_tool from response, doesn't

[dave] [#7981] add per-thread subscription icon

------------------------------------------
[...truncated 1772 lines...]
├── debug@2.3.3 (ms@0.7.2)
└── broccoli-plugin@1.3.0 (rimraf@2.5.4, promise-map-series@0.2.3, 
quick-temp@0.1.6)

broccoli-sourcemap-concat@2.0.2 node_modules/broccoli-sourcemap-concat
├── minimatch@2.0.10 (brace-expansion@1.1.6)
├── lodash.uniq@3.2.2 (lodash._getnative@3.9.1, 
lodash._isiterateecall@3.0.9, lodash.isarray@3.0.4, lodash._baseuniq@3.0.3, 
lodash._basecallback@3.3.1)
├── mkdirp@0.5.1 (minimist@0.0.8)
├── broccoli-kitchen-sink-helpers@0.2.9 (glob@5.0.15)
├── fast-sourcemap-concat@0.2.7 (source-map-url@0.3.0, debug@2.3.3, 
chalk@0.5.1, source-map@0.4.4, rsvp@3.3.3)
├── broccoli-caching-writer@2.3.1 (debug@2.3.3, walk-sync@0.2.7, 
rimraf@2.5.4, rsvp@3.3.3, broccoli-plugin@1.1.0)
└── lodash-node@2.4.1

broccoli-funnel@0.2.15 node_modules/broccoli-funnel
├── fast-ordered-set@1.0.3
├── blank-object@1.0.2
├── array-equal@1.0.0
├── path-posix@1.0.0
├── symlink-or-copy@1.1.8
├── fs-tree-diff@0.3.1
├── minimatch@2.0.10 (brace-expansion@1.1.6)
├── debug@2.3.3 (ms@0.7.2)
├── walk-sync@0.2.7 (ensure-posix-path@1.0.2, matcher-collection@1.0.4)
├── rimraf@2.5.4 (glob@7.1.1)
├── mkdirp@0.5.1 (minimist@0.0.8)
└── broccoli-plugin@1.3.0 (quick-temp@0.1.6, promise-map-series@0.2.3)

broccoli-timepiece@0.3.0 node_modules/broccoli-timepiece
├── rimraf@2.2.8
├── chalk@0.5.1 (ansi-styles@1.1.0, escape-string-regexp@1.0.5, 
supports-color@0.2.0, strip-ansi@0.3.0, has-ansi@0.1.0)
├── broccoli-kitchen-sink-helpers@0.2.9 (glob@5.0.15, mkdirp@0.5.1)
└── broccoli@0.13.6 (promise-map-series@0.2.3, broccoli-slow-trees@1.1.0, 
copy-dereference@1.0.0, mime@1.3.4, commander@2.9.0, connect@3.5.0, 
findup-sync@0.1.3, rsvp@3.3.3, tiny-lr@0.1.7, handlebars@2.0.0)

broccoli-babel-transpiler@5.6.1 node_modules/broccoli-babel-transpiler
├── clone@0.2.0
├── json-stable-stringify@1.0.1 (jsonify@0.0.0)
├── hash-for-dep@1.0.3 (resolve@1.1.7, 
broccoli-kitchen-sink-helpers@0.3.1)
├── broccoli-merge-trees@1.2.1 (symlink-or-copy@1.1.8, 
fast-ordered-set@1.0.3, fs-tree-diff@0.5.5, rimraf@2.5.4, 
heimdalljs-logger@0.1.7, can-symlink@1.0.0, broccoli-plugin@1.3.0, 
heimdalljs@0.2.3)
├── broccoli-persistent-filter@1.2.11 (promise-map-series@0.2.3, 
blank-object@1.0.2, symlink-or-copy@1.1.8, md5-hex@1.3.0, fs-tree-diff@0.5.5, 
mkdirp@0.5.1, walk-sync@0.3.1, rsvp@3.3.3, heimdalljs-logger@0.1.7, 
async-disk-cache@1.0.9, broccoli-plugin@1.3.0, heimdalljs@0.2.3)
├── broccoli-funnel@1.1.0 (exists-sync@0.0.4, array-equal@1.0.0, 
path-posix@1.0.0, fast-ordered-set@1.0.3, blank-object@1.0.2, 
symlink-or-copy@1.1.8, walk-sync@0.3.1, debug@2.3.3, minimatch@3.0.3, 
mkdirp@0.5.1, rimraf@2.5.4, fs-tree-diff@0.5.5, broccoli-plugin@1.3.0, 
heimdalljs@0.2.3)
└── babel-core@5.8.38 (slash@1.0.0, try-resolve@1.0.1, 
babel-plugin-remove-console@1.0.1, babel-plugin-remove-debugger@1.0.1, 
babel-plugin-eval@1.0.1, babel-plugin-jscript@1.0.4, 
babel-plugin-property-literals@1.0.1, 
babel-plugin-inline-environment-variables@1.0.1, 
babel-plugin-react-constant-elements@1.0.3, 
babel-plugin-undefined-to-void@1.1.6, 
babel-plugin-member-expression-literals@1.0.1, to-fast-properties@1.0.2, 
shebang-regex@1.0.0, babel-plugin-react-display-name@1.0.3, trim-right@1.0.1, 
path-exists@1.0.0, path-is-absolute@1.0.1, fs-readdir-recursive@0.1.2, 
babel-plugin-constant-folding@1.0.1, babel-plugin-proto-to-assign@1.0.4, 
babel-plugin-dead-code-elimination@1.0.2, babel-plugin-runtime@1.0.7, 
private@0.1.6, globals@6.4.1, esutils@2.0.2, home-or-tmp@1.0.0, 
babel-plugin-undeclared-variables-check@1.0.2, convert-source-map@1.3.0, 
js-tokens@1.0.1, debug@2.3.3, repeating@1.1.3, detect-indent@3.0.1, 
chalk@1.1.3, minimatch@2.0.10, is-integer@1.0.6, babylon@5.8.38, resolve@1.1.7, 
output-file-sync@1.1.2, bluebird@2.11.0, json5@0.4.0, source-map@0.5.6, 
regexpu@1.3.0, source-map-support@0.2.10, lodash@3.10.1, regenerator@0.8.40, 
core-js@1.2.7)

broccoli@0.16.9 node_modules/broccoli
├── promise-map-series@0.2.3
├── broccoli-slow-trees@1.1.0
├── copy-dereference@1.0.0
├── mime@1.3.4
├── commander@2.9.0 (graceful-readlink@1.0.1)
├── connect@3.5.0 (utils-merge@1.0.0, parseurl@1.3.1, debug@2.2.0, 
finalhandler@0.5.0)
├── findup-sync@0.2.1 (glob@4.3.5)
├── broccoli-kitchen-sink-helpers@0.2.9 (mkdirp@0.5.1, glob@5.0.15)
├── rimraf@2.5.4 (glob@7.1.1)
├── rsvp@3.3.3
├── quick-temp@0.1.6 (mktemp@0.4.0, rimraf@2.2.8, underscore.string@2.3.3)
└── handlebars@4.0.6 (async@1.5.2, source-map@0.4.4, optimist@0.6.1, 
uglify-js@2.7.5)

eslint@1.10.3 node_modules/eslint
├── path-is-inside@1.0.2
├── escape-string-regexp@1.0.5
├── path-is-absolute@1.0.1
├── object-assign@4.1.0
├── xml-escape@1.0.0
├── strip-json-comments@1.0.4
├── estraverse-fb@1.3.1
├── globals@8.18.0
├── estraverse@4.2.0
├── text-table@0.2.0
├── esutils@2.0.2
├── is-resolvable@1.0.0 (tryit@1.0.3)
├── user-home@2.0.0 (os-homedir@1.0.2)
├── debug@2.3.3 (ms@0.7.2)
├── lodash.merge@3.3.2 (lodash._arrayeach@3.0.0, lodash._arraycopy@3.0.0, 
lodash._getnative@3.9.1, lodash.istypedarray@3.0.6, lodash.isarray@3.0.4, 
lodash.isarguments@3.1.0, lodash.keys@3.1.2, lodash.keysin@3.0.8, 
lodash.isplainobject@3.2.0, lodash.toplainobject@3.0.0, 
lodash._createassigner@3.1.1)
├── json-stable-stringify@1.0.1 (jsonify@0.0.0)
├── chalk@1.1.3 (supports-color@2.0.0, ansi-styles@2.2.1, has-ansi@2.0.0, 
strip-ansi@3.0.1)
├── minimatch@3.0.3 (brace-expansion@1.1.6)
├── lodash.omit@3.1.0 (lodash._arraymap@3.0.0, 
lodash._bindcallback@3.0.1, lodash._pickbyarray@3.0.2, lodash.restparam@3.6.1, 
lodash.keysin@3.0.8, lodash._pickbycallback@3.0.0, lodash._baseflatten@3.1.4, 
lodash._basedifference@3.0.3)
├── glob@5.0.15 (inherits@2.0.3, inflight@1.0.6, once@1.4.0)
├── optionator@0.6.0 (fast-levenshtein@1.0.7, type-check@0.3.2, 
deep-is@0.1.3, levn@0.2.5, prelude-ls@1.1.2, wordwrap@0.0.3)
├── mkdirp@0.5.1 (minimist@0.0.8)
├── lodash.clonedeep@3.0.2 (lodash._bindcallback@3.0.1, 
lodash._baseclone@3.3.0)
├── doctrine@0.7.2 (isarray@0.0.1, esutils@1.1.6)
├── shelljs@0.5.3
├── concat-stream@1.5.2 (inherits@2.0.3, typedarray@0.0.6, 
readable-stream@2.0.6)
├── espree@2.2.5
├── is-my-json-valid@2.15.0 (generate-function@2.0.0, xtend@4.0.1, 
jsonpointer@4.0.0, generate-object-property@1.2.0)
├── file-entry-cache@1.3.1 (flat-cache@1.2.1)
├── js-yaml@3.4.5 (esprima@2.7.3, argparse@1.0.9)
├── inquirer@0.11.4 (strip-ansi@3.0.1, ansi-escapes@1.4.0, 
ansi-regex@2.0.0, figures@1.7.0, through@2.3.8, cli-width@1.1.1, 
cli-cursor@1.0.2, run-async@0.1.0, readline2@1.0.1, string-width@1.0.2, 
rx-lite@3.1.2, lodash@3.10.1)
├── handlebars@4.0.6 (async@1.5.2, optimist@0.6.1, source-map@0.4.4, 
uglify-js@2.7.5)
└── escope@3.6.0 (esrecurse@4.1.0, es6-weak-map@2.0.1, es6-map@0.1.4)

babel-eslint@5.0.4 node_modules/babel-eslint
├── acorn-to-esprima@2.0.8
├── lodash.assign@3.2.0 (lodash._createassigner@3.1.1, lodash.keys@3.1.2, 
lodash._baseassign@3.2.0)
├── babylon@6.14.1
├── lodash.pick@3.1.0 (lodash._bindcallback@3.0.1, 
lodash._pickbyarray@3.0.2, lodash.restparam@3.6.1, lodash._baseflatten@3.1.4, 
lodash._pickbycallback@3.0.0)
├── babel-types@6.19.0 (to-fast-properties@1.0.2, esutils@2.0.2, 
lodash@4.17.2, babel-runtime@6.18.0)
└── babel-traverse@6.19.0 (babel-messages@6.8.0, globals@9.14.0, 
debug@2.3.3, invariant@2.2.2, babel-code-frame@6.16.0, lodash@4.17.2, 
babel-runtime@6.18.0)
Not running tests for virtualenv-1.9.1, since it isn't set up
<DummyProcess(Thread-1, started daemon 139779772438272)> running `nosetests  
--with-xunitmp --cover-package=alluratest --processes=4 --process-timeout=360` 
in AlluraTest

<DummyProcess(Thread-2, started daemon 139779764045568)> running `nosetests 
allura/tests/ --with-xunitmp --cover-package=allura --processes=4 
--process-timeout=360` in Allura

<DummyProcess(Thread-3, started daemon 139779755652864)> running `nosetests  
--with-xunitmp --cover-package=forgeactivity --processes=4 
--process-timeout=360` in ForgeActivity

<DummyProcess(Thread-4, started daemon 139779747260160)> running `nosetests  
--with-xunitmp --cover-package=forgeblog --processes=4 --process-timeout=360` 
in ForgeBlog

............No config file found, using default configuration
.No config file found, using default configuration
.No config file found, using default configuration
.No config file found, using default configuration
...................
----------------------------------------------------------------------
Ran 19 tests in 8.929s

OK
finished `nosetests  --with-xunitmp --cover-package=forgeactivity --processes=4 
--process-timeout=360` in ForgeActivity
<DummyProcess(Thread-3, started daemon 139779755652864)> running `nosetests  
--with-xunitmp --cover-package=forgechat --processes=4 --process-timeout=360` 
in ForgeChat

.No config file found, using default configuration
.No config file found, using default configuration
.No config file found, using default configuration
..
----------------------------------------------------------------------
Ran 2 tests in 2.645s

OK
finished `nosetests  --with-xunitmp --cover-package=forgechat --processes=4 
--process-timeout=360` in ForgeChat
<DummyProcess(Thread-3, started daemon 139779755652864)> running `nosetests  
--with-xunitmp --cover-package=forgediscussion --processes=4 
--process-timeout=360` in ForgeDiscussion

.No config file found, using default configuration
.No config file found, using default configuration
....No config file found, using default configuration
.No config file found, using default configuration
.No config file found, using default configuration
.
----------------------------------------------------------------------
Ran 27 tests in 17.701s

OK
finished `nosetests  --with-xunitmp --cover-package=alluratest --processes=4 
--process-timeout=360` in AlluraTest
<DummyProcess(Thread-1, started daemon 139779772438272)> running `nosetests  
--with-xunitmp --cover-package=forgegit ` in ForgeGit

...............................................SSS..
----------------------------------------------------------------------
Ran 52 tests in 20.237s

OK (SKIP=3)
finished `nosetests  --with-xunitmp --cover-package=forgeblog --processes=4 
--process-timeout=360` in ForgeBlog
<DummyProcess(Thread-4, started daemon 139779747260160)> running `nosetests  
--with-xunitmp --cover-package=forgeimporters --processes=4 
--process-timeout=360` in ForgeImporters

.................................................S.....................................................SSSS..SS..........S.
----------------------------------------------------------------------
Ran 123 tests in 23.316s

OK (SKIP=8)
finished `nosetests  --with-xunitmp --cover-package=forgeimporters 
--processes=4 --process-timeout=360` in ForgeImporters
<DummyProcess(Thread-4, started daemon 139779747260160)> running `nosetests  
--with-xunitmp --cover-package=forgelink --processes=4 --process-timeout=360` 
in ForgeLink

.................
----------------------------------------------------------------------
Ran 17 tests in 6.335s

OK
finished `nosetests  --with-xunitmp --cover-package=forgelink --processes=4 
--process-timeout=360` in ForgeLink
<DummyProcess(Thread-4, started daemon 139779747260160)> running `nosetests  
--with-xunitmp --cover-package=forgesvn ` in ForgeSVN

..................................................................
----------------------------------------------------------------------
Ran 66 tests in 43.098s

OK
finished `nosetests  --with-xunitmp --cover-package=forgediscussion 
--processes=4 --process-timeout=360` in ForgeDiscussion
<DummyProcess(Thread-3, started daemon 139779755652864)> running `nosetests  
--with-xunitmp --cover-package=forgeshorturl --processes=4 
--process-timeout=360` in ForgeShortUrl

...........
----------------------------------------------------------------------
Ran 11 tests in 4.934s

OK
finished `nosetests  --with-xunitmp --cover-package=forgeshorturl --processes=4 
--process-timeout=360` in ForgeShortUrl
<DummyProcess(Thread-3, started daemon 139779755652864)> running `nosetests  
--with-xunitmp --cover-package=forgetracker --processes=4 
--process-timeout=360` in ForgeTracker

.................................................................................................................................................................................................
----------------------------------------------------------------------
Ran 193 tests in 98.743s

OK
finished `nosetests  --with-xunitmp --cover-package=forgetracker --processes=4 
--process-timeout=360` in ForgeTracker
<DummyProcess(Thread-3, started daemon 139779755652864)> running `nosetests  
--with-xunitmp --cover-package=forgeuserstats --processes=4 
--process-timeout=360` in ForgeUserStats

............
----------------------------------------------------------------------
Ran 12 tests in 11.430s

OK
finished `nosetests  --with-xunitmp --cover-package=forgeuserstats 
--processes=4 --process-timeout=360` in ForgeUserStats
<DummyProcess(Thread-3, started daemon 139779755652864)> running `nosetests  
--with-xunitmp --cover-package=forgewiki --processes=4 --process-timeout=360` 
in ForgeWiki


======================================================================
FAIL: allura.tests.test_globals.test_macro_neighborhood_feeds
----------------------------------------------------------------------
Traceback (most recent call last):
  File 
"<https://builds.apache.org/job/Allura/ws/.allura-venv/local/lib/python2.7/site-packages/nose/case.py";,>
 line 197, in runTest
    self.test(*self.arg)
  File 
"<https://builds.apache.org/job/Allura/ws/Allura/allura/tests/test_globals.py";,>
 line 198, in test_macro_neighborhood_feeds
    assert new_len == orig_len
AssertionError: 
-------------------- >> begin captured logging << --------------------
allura.model.artifact: DEBUG: Snapshot version 2 of <class 
'forgewiki.model.wiki.Page'>
--------------------- >> end captured logging << ---------------------

----------------------------------------------------------------------
Ran 1117 tests in 197.783s

FAILED (SKIP=13, failures=1)
finished `nosetests allura/tests/ --with-xunitmp --cover-package=allura 
--processes=4 --process-timeout=360` in Allura
<DummyProcess(Thread-2, started daemon 139779764045568)> running `npm run 
lint-es6` in .


> allura@0.0.0 lint-es6 <https://builds.apache.org/job/Allura/ws/>
> eslint -c .eslintrc-es6  --ignore-path .eslintignore-es6 
> Allura/allura/public/**/*.es6.js || true

finished `npm run lint-es6` in .
...........................................................S........
----------------------------------------------------------------------
Ran 68 tests in 29.948s

OK (SKIP=1)
finished `nosetests  --with-xunitmp --cover-package=forgewiki --processes=4 
--process-timeout=360` in ForgeWiki
..........................................................................................
----------------------------------------------------------------------
Ran 90 tests in 159.831s

OK
finished `nosetests  --with-xunitmp --cover-package=forgesvn ` in ForgeSVN
.........................................................................................................................................
----------------------------------------------------------------------
Ran 137 tests in 231.232s

OK
finished `nosetests  --with-xunitmp --cover-package=forgegit ` in ForgeGit
Running setup_app() from allura.websetup
/p/test/wiki/_discuss/thread/13142955/ 200 OK
{"sidebar": 1, "jinja": 1, "markdown": 4, "ming": 111}
Build step 'Execute shell' marked build as failure
Recording plot data
Skipping Cobertura coverage report as build was not SUCCESS or better ...
Recording test results

Reply via email to